Four actors play Salvador Dalí, the iconic surrealist artist.
A French journalist is working on a documentary on Salvador Dalí, played by four different actors. His work won’t be completed, though. Dupieux’s film is an ironic parable on the narcissism of great artists.

Quentin Dupieux

Born in Paris in 1974, Quentin Dupieux is a director and musical producer. He debuted with featurette Nonfilm of 2022, an example his taste for the absurd and the nonsensical, which also appears in Steak (2007) and Rubber (2010), the latter presented at Cannes’ Semaine de la Critique. In 2012, he participated in the Turin Film Festival with feature film Wrong. Dupieux will be at Cannes again in the Quinzaine des réalisateurs section with Deerskin in 2019, at the Venice Film Festival with Mandibles in 2020, at the Berlinale with Incredible but true in 2022, and again at Cannes in the Un Certain Regard section with Smoking Causes Coughing.
